NCMEC
If your child has gone missing, or if you have worries about a child's safety, NCMEC is here to help you. This group is dedicated to finding missing children and fighting the harm of children through a variety of programs and services.
NCMEC offers a wide range of resources, including:
* A toll-free number for reporting missing children
* An portal of missing children's cases
* Educational materials for parents and educators on child safety
* A internet reporting system
NCMEC also works closely with law enforcement agencies, social workers, and other organizations to provide the safest possible environment for children.

The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network (RAINN)
If a friend has click here gone through sexual violence, get help from the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network (RAINN). RAINN is a trusted organization that gives help to survivors of sexual assault. Their 24/7 hotline is available at 800-656-HOPE and they have online support at RAINN.org. RAINN's mission is to stop sexual violence andassist survivors.
